Let’s define Crypto Liquidity Pools!

Crypto liquidity pools, in particular, are groups of funds that are put into a smart contract to provide liquidity for DEX, lending and borrowing protocols, and other DeFi applications.

In DeFi markets, traders and investors can get into the market through a liquidity pool.

What’s the importance of a Crypto Liquidity Pool?

Any experienced trader, whether on traditional markets or crypto markets, would warn you about the risks of trading in a market with less liquidity. Slippage will be a problem whether you are trying to buy or sell a low-cap cryptocurrency or a penny stock. 

In the classic order book model, the bid-ask spread of the order book for a given trading pair sets this market order price. It is used when there aren’t many trades or when the market is very unstable. This means that it’s the price where buyers are willing to pay and sellers are willing to sell. Low liquidity, on the other hand, can cause more slippage, and depending on the bid-ask spread for the asset at the time, the executed trading price can be much higher than the original market order price.

Liquidity pools try to fix markets that aren’t very liquid by giving users a cut of their trading fees in p2p crypto exchange development for providing crypto liquidity. When you use liquidity pool protocols to trade, like Bancor or Uniswap, buyers and sellers don’t have to be matched. This means that users can easily trade their tokens and assets with other users by using the liquidity they provide and smart contracts to make the trades.

How do Crypto Liquidity Pools work?

Crypto liquidity providers often get LP tokens based on how much liquidity they’ve added to the pool. When a pool makes a trade possible, the LP token holders share a small fee in an even way. To get back the money they gave and the fees they got in return, the liquidity provider must destroy their LP tokens.

Because AMM algorithms keep the prices of tokens in a pool in line with each other, liquidity pools keep the tokens they hold at fair market values. The algorithms that are used by the liquidity pools of different protocols may be a little bit different. For example, Uniswap liquidity pools use a constant product formula to keep price ratios stable, and many DEX platforms do the same. This method makes sure that a pool always provides liquidity to the crypto market by controlling the price and ratio of the right tokens as demand grows.

Why are the potential benefits of Crypto Liquidity Pools?

Even though it can be hard for people who are new to cryptocurrency to join liquidity pools at first, the benefits of these new financial protocols show that liquidity pools are here to stay.

Let’s look at some of these good things.

  • DeFi protocols, like decentralized exchanges and lending platforms, need liquidity pools to make sure they have enough money to use.
  • Liquidity is not something that all market makers can get. Anyone can put more money into a pool.
  • Liquidity providers can make money in many different ways by putting their tokens on different DeFi protocols.
  • Because of liquidity pools, traders can do business without having to trust each other.
